On Sat, 2019-06-01 at 23:29 +0100, James Le Cuirot wrote:
> Unfortunately my conception of ESYSROOT was a little short-sighted. It
> was previously defined as SYSROOT + EPREFIX but if SYSROOT does not
> equal ROOT then EPREFIX does not make sense in this context. Consider
> a more concrete example:
> 

Once again, you are missing the point that e.g. pkg-config files will
have EPREFIX hardcoded.
